Roberts, Karlene – Online Submission, 2022
The number of nontraditional students in colleges in the United States has been and is continuing to rise, but these students face difficulties that affect their motivation to persist towards graduation. Some of these difficulties include balancing multiple roles, including work, school and family demands, lack of support, financial constraints,…

Sahin, Mehmet; Erisen, Yavuz; Çeliköz, Nadir – Online Submission, 2016
Mezirow (1991) defines transformative learning as a theory about constructing meaning, not just about knowledge acquisition, and the construction of meaning is about learning through critical reflection, rather than mindlessly or unquestioningly acquiring frames of reference through life experiences.
